The energy (in eV) required to excite an electron from ( n=2 ) to ( n=4 ) state in hydrogen atom is

Options

  1. A+ ( 2.55 )
  2. B- ( 3.4 )
  3. C( -0.85 )
  4. D+ ( 4.25 )

Correct answer

A. + ( 2.55 )

Step-by-step solution

In a hydrogen atom, energy required to excite an electron from state E₁ to state E_ f is E=E_ f -E_ i where energy of a state n is given by array l E_ n = -13.6 n² eV E₄= -13.6 42 = -13.6 16 =-0.85 eV and E₂= -13.6 2² = -13.6 4 =-3.4 eV array Therefore, E=E₄-E₂=-0.85-(-3.4)=(3.4-0.85) e ~V Thus, energy required =2.55 eV
